Output 7e49036fdf22dbfa39ccddcdb40a61310c94df07b2133f392338756847dc9f63:0

value
26031652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852683de941e00a5a284ce03a9b2a7028f722f2f OP_EQUAL
address
ML3CF2A2T328pMxDkXNJo6NpTrkrYx56Tj
transaction
7e49036fdf22dbfa39ccddcdb40a61310c94df07b2133f392338756847dc9f63
spent
true